Yeah shop-bought quiche is fine :) I'd probably heat it just to be safe because I'm kind of paranoid about food but there's no reason why it should be a problem to eat cold because it's all cooked properly already.
 
There is no point whatsoever in heating it then letting it cool. In fact, this might allow more bacteria to breed while it is cooling down. And you might end up eating it at an inbetween temperature which is less safe. The product has already been cooked.

You can eat quiche either hot or cold. It is made of cooked eggs which are fine. If you choose to eat it cold then make sure it has been properly stored in the fridge at 5 degrees.
If you choose to have it hot then make sure it is properly warmed through.
 
Yep it's fine to eat it cold - it's already cooked, it's not as if it's raw egg you'd be eating :) I love quiche!
